Welcome to Abberley HallInternational Summer SchoolAbberley Hall Summer School welcomes international children aged 8-12 for an idyllic and traditional English summer school experience. Abberley Hall is set in the heart of the beautiful Worcestershire countryside, in the West Midlands region of England. The school provides a safe, secure and picturesque setting with 90 acres of private grounds, including playing fields and woodland.

The Abberley Hall Summer School offers a fantastic mix of English classes, fun activities and engaging excursions to enable the children to get the most out of their summer school experience. With children joining us from all over the world, the summer school provides a wonderful opportunity for learning English and having lots of fun, all within a supportive and secure environment.

Abberley Hall Summer School is operated and staffed by Summer Boarding Courses Ltd.

The English ProgrammeMorning Lessons - English LanguageThe English language lessons take place on 5 mornings each week, giving the children 15 hours of dedicated language tuition per week. The morning after the arrival day, the children are tested to gauge their English level and placed in classes on the basis of ability, age and nationality. The lessons are delivered by professionally qualified, friendly teachers with class sizes limited to a maximum of 15, giving every child the chance to receive lots of individual attention.

Morning Lessons - Summer StudyOur Summer Study option offers a content-based learning approach, providing children with the opportunity to develop their English skills through the study of other subjects. The subjects studied, all taught in English, include History, Geography, Creative Writing, English Literature and Science. Summer Study takes place during the 3 hours of morning lessons which take place on 5 days each week, replacing the general English language classes. Our Summer Study option is for children of an Upper Intermediate and Advanced level of English. Children can study on the Summer Study course for a maximum of 3 weeks.

Project Work & Day Trip PreparationWhen learning a language, it’s important that it is put into a real context to enable the children to express their interests and experiences. Each week the students work on a group project, such as a play for the Talent Show or a Class Film, to put their English into practice. They will also have a lesson to prepare them for their day trips.

Reports & CertificatesEach child’s progress is monitored closely during their stay with us and on departure all students receive an Abberley Hall Summer School Certificate, plus a progress report.

English Plus+On 2 afternoons each week, children can choose to take part in our English Plus+ activities. The English Plus+ activities are specialist courses run by professional instructors. The English Plus+ activities are an optional extra and can be selected at the time of booking. If an English Plus+ course is selected, this will replace the Multi-Activity Programme on 2 afternoons per week. It is only possible to select 1 option each week.

The choices are as follows:

English Plus+ Horse RidingChildren will learn how to ride and look after horses with qualified instructors in the beautiful Worcestershire countryside. Our Horse Riding course is suitable for both beginners, who may never have ridden before, or those children with more experience who ride regularly.

English Plus+ Adventure SportsThis course is for our more adventurous students and includes activities such as kayaking, laser quest, climbing and woodland survival skills. The Adventure Sports course is led by qualified professionals, accompanied by our own staff.

English Plus+ ShowtimeThis fun and creative performance course combines dance, drama and singing. Led by our very own performing arts staff, our students will create performance pieces for the Abberley Hall Summer School Show. As the Showtime course works towards an end-of-course performance, it can only be selected for 2 or 4 weeks.

AccommodationThe accommodation at Abberley Hall is ideal for children aged 8 to 12 as the dormitories enable them to get to know each other quickly and form strong friendships. The girls and boys are accommodated in different boarding houses in dorm rooms. All the rooms are bright and spacious, providing a friendly environment for the children to feel settled and comfortable while away from home.

MealsThe students have three meals a day in the school’s historic dining rooms. For breakfast, a continental option is available each day, with a hot English breakfast also offered on three mornings each week.

There are always two hot choices for lunch and dinner including a vegetarian option, and a salad bar, fresh bread, fruit and desserts. We provide afternoon snacks, plus drinks and biscuits before bed.

Travel InformationTravelChildren’s travel to and from England must be paid for independently. Once your booking has been confirmed, we will ask you to provide us with travel details. It is important that these are provided as soon as possible.

TransfersA taxi transfer service is available to and from Abberley Hall on scheduled arrival and departure days. Students who have booked an arrival airport transfer will be met at the airport upon their arrival by our summer school staff. All our staff will be wearing a bright yellow t-Shirt with ‘SBC’ on the front and ‘Transfer team’ on the back.

Children requiring a departure airport transfer will be escorted to the airport by our staff. Once at the airport, our staff will assist the children will the check-in procedure and take them through to security where they will be handed over to the care of airport staff.

We would recommend that if your child will be flying to the UK without a parent or guardian you request Unaccompanied Minor assistance direct from the airline.

Parent Transfer:Parents or guardians who would like to bring their children to the school are asked to arrive between 13.00 and 16.00. There will be an opportunity to have a look around the school and help the children settle into their rooms.

Parents who wish to collect their children on departure days are asked to arrive between 09.00 and 11.00.
